We have an opportunity for an exceptional Higher Level Teaching Assistant to join the team at Cabot Primary School.
We are looking for a person who puts children and their learning at the centre of their work. We believe that building strong, respectful relationships with children and their families is very important and that children learn best when they are happy, calm and safe.
We are seeking applicants who will continue to promote our inclusive and friendly ethos and continue to develop excellent provision across the school, supporting our amazing pupils and staff. We offer a high-quality professional development programme and the opportunity to work with a close knit and supportive team both within the school and across the Trust.
We require HLTAs to deliver pre planned lessons building strong relationships and supporting them to be successful. You must either have the HLTA qualification or be working towards it.
